Who makes the v1 headset ?

BlueAnt makes the V1 headset. A small start-up company called ALT modifies the headset to by-pass the need for the BlueAnt Button.

Is the headset warranted ?

Yes, ALT warranties the headset to be free of defects in material or workmanship for 1 year. The BlueAnt warranty is voided because of the modifications.

What if I cannot speak clearly ?

If the BlueAnt headset cannot understand your voice you can still receive calls by simply tipping your head forward when a call is incoming.

Is my phone compatible ?

If your phone has Bluetooth it more than likely supports a Handsfree or Headset Bluetooth profile, and so will work with the V1. Check your phone's manual for up to date information.

Does this headset work any different than a non-modified BlueAnt V1 headset ?

The only difference is you do not have to push the BlueAnt button to make or receive a call or to turn the headset on or off. The headset has been modified so that the need to push the BlueAnt button is replaced by tipping your head forward to initiate a command that normally is controlled by pushing the button.

Great for anyone who cannot push a button.

 

Works well for quadriplegics or anyone who does not have the dexterity to push a small button.

 

Also great for anyone who works with gloves on, whose hands are constantly dirty or too busy to stop and push a headset button to make a call.
